Game summary

The Washington Commanders beat the New York Giants 20–7 on 2003-12-07. T. Hasselbeck posted a game-high +13.46 total EPA in the passing.

The highest-scoring period was Q1 with 10 combined points.

Drive & efficiency notes

Despite the final score, Washington Commanders generated the better offensive EPA per play (+0.04 vs -0.20), suggesting they moved the ball more efficiently.

Season benchmark context (offensive EPA per play):

  • Washington Commanders: +0.04 EPA/play (62nd percentile vs. 2003 team-game averages)
  • New York Giants: -0.20 EPA/play (11th percentile vs. 2003 team-game averages)
  • New York Giants: 10 drives, -13.76 total EPA, 1 scoring drives
  • Washington Commanders: 11 drives, +3.16 total EPA, 4 scoring drives
